pkgsrc - initial commit
[pkgsrc.git] / print / lilypond / Makefile
1 # $NetBSD: Makefile,v 1.60 2009/06/03 19:52:33 hasso Exp $
2 #
3
4 DISTNAME=       lilypond-2.12.2
5 CATEGORIES=     print
6 MASTER_SITES=   http://lilypond.org/download/sources/v2.12/
7
8 MAINTAINER=     pkgsrc-users@NetBSD.org
9 HOMEPAGE=       http://lilypond.org/web/
10 COMMENT=        GNU Music Typesetter
11
12 PKG_DESTDIR_SUPPORT=    user-destdir
13
14 DEPENDS+=       ec-fonts-mftraced-[0-9]*:../../fonts/ec-fonts-mftraced
15
16 BUILDLINK_API_DEPENDS.mftrace+= mftrace>=1.1.0
17
18 GNU_CONFIGURE=          YES
19 USE_PKGLOCALEDIR=       YES
20 USE_LANGUAGES=          c c++
21 USE_TOOLS+=             bison flex gmake gs:run makeinfo perl pkg-config msgfmt
22 MAKE_FILE=              GNUmakefile
23
24 .include "../../mk/bsd.prefs.mk"
25
26 TEXINFO_REQD=           4.11
27 GCC_REQD+=              3.0.5
28
29 GNU_CONFIGURE_INFODIR=  ${PREFIX}/${PKGINFODIR}
30 INFO_DIR=               ${GNU_CONFIGURE_INFODIR}
31 INFO_FILES=             YES
32
33 CONFIGURE_ARGS+=        --with-ncsb-dir=${LOCALBASE}/share/ghostscript/fonts
34 CONFIGURE_ARGS+=        --disable-optimising
35 CONFIGURE_ENV+=         PYTHON=${PYTHONBIN:Q}
36 PYTHON_VERSIONS_ACCEPTED= 25 24
37
38 PLIST_SUBST+=   PKGVERSION=${PKGVERSION:S/nb${PKGREVISION}//}
39
40 # 1.7 coredumps when generating eps files
41 DEPENDS+=       potrace>=1.8:../../graphics/potrace
42
43 .include "../../devel/pango/buildlink3.mk"
44 .include "../../fonts/fontconfig/buildlink3.mk"
45 .include "../../fonts/mftrace/buildlink3.mk"
46 .include "../../lang/guile/buildlink3.mk"
47 .include "../../lang/python/application.mk"
48 .include "../../mk/omf-scrollkeeper.mk"
49 .include "../../mk/tex.buildlink3.mk"
50 .include "../../mk/bsd.pkg.mk"